How to Implement Journalist Outreach Strategies for WooCommerce Growth
1. Research and Segment Journalists by Beat and Audience
Begin by identifying journalists who cover ecommerce, retail technology, or WooCommerce-specific topics. Use media databases like Muck Rack or Cision to filter contacts by their coverage areas—product reviews, industry trends, or business growth stories. Prioritize journalists whose audiences align with your ideal customer profiles.
Example: If your WooCommerce store recently enhanced checkout flows to reduce cart abandonment, target journalists who write about ecommerce UX or conversion optimization.
2. Craft Personalized, Data-Backed Pitches Addressing Ecommerce Challenges
Personalization is the cornerstone of effective pitching. Reference a journalist’s recent article on checkout optimization to demonstrate you’ve done your homework. Present concise, data-driven insights, such as how your store reduced cart abandonment by 30% through personalized product recommendations.
Include clear metrics and actionable takeaways to establish your credibility and relevance.
Tool tip: Use Pitchbox to automate personalized outreach and follow-ups, ensuring timely and scalable communication.

4. Use Storytelling to Highlight Customer Experience Improvements
Data alone isn’t enough—craft narratives around authentic customer success stories. For instance, describe how personalized product recommendations increased average order value by 20%. Storytelling creates an emotional connection that resonates with journalists and their audiences, making your innovations relatable and memorable.
5. Provide Product or Demo Access for Hands-On Reviews
Invite journalists to experience your WooCommerce store firsthand by offering demo accounts or guided walkthroughs. Let them explore your optimized checkout flows, personalized upsell offers, or new features. This transparency builds trust and encourages authentic, positive reviews.
6. Follow Up Strategically Without Being Intrusive
Send a polite follow-up email 5-7 days after your initial pitch. Reference any new developments or additional data to add value. Avoid excessive follow-ups to maintain goodwill and professionalism.
7. Engage Journalists on Social Media and Ecommerce Communities
Build rapport by interacting with journalists on LinkedIn, Twitter, or relevant ecommerce forums. Comment thoughtfully on their posts and share insights. Join WooCommerce communities where journalists participate to foster ongoing relationships beyond email outreach.
8. Enhance Your Pitches with Multimedia Assets
Visual content makes your pitch more engaging and easier to digest. Include infographics illustrating cart abandonment trends before and after your improvements or short videos showcasing your personalized checkout experience.
Tool recommendation: Use Canva to design professional infographics and videos quickly and cost-effectively.
9. Collaborate on Trend Reports or Thought Leadership Articles
Partner with journalists or industry experts to co-author articles on emerging ecommerce trends like personalization or post-purchase feedback. This collaboration elevates your brand’s authority and increases your media visibility.
10. Monitor and Respond Promptly to Media Inquiries
Set up alerts with tools like Mention or Google Alerts to track journalist queries related to ecommerce topics. Respond quickly and helpfully to build lasting media relationships and seize timely opportunities.

Measuring the Impact of Journalist Outreach on Your WooCommerce Store
Key Metrics to Track
| Metric | How to Measure | Why It Matters |
|---|---|---|
| Media Coverage Volume & Quality | Count placements; assess publication relevance | Indicates brand visibility and reach |
| Referral Traffic | Use Google Analytics to track media-driven visits | Measures audience engagement |
| Conversion Rate Changes | Monitor checkout completion before/after coverage | Shows direct impact on sales |
| Social Media Engagement | Track increases in followers, shares, comments | Reflects audience interest and buzz |
| Inbound Media Inquiries | Count journalist contacts post-outreach | Signals relationship-building success |
| SEO Impact | Analyze backlinks and domain authority | Improves organic search rankings |

FAQ: Journalist Outreach for WooCommerce Stores
How do I find journalists who cover WooCommerce and ecommerce topics?
Use media databases like Muck Rack or Cision, filtering by beats such as ecommerce and retail technology. Monitor bylines in leading ecommerce publications to discover relevant journalists.
What makes a journalist outreach pitch stand out?
Personalize your pitch by referencing the journalist’s recent work and include exclusive, data-backed insights from your WooCommerce store. Adding visual assets like infographics or videos further increases engagement.
How frequently should I follow up after sending a pitch?
A polite follow-up 5-7 days after your initial email is ideal. Avoid multiple follow-ups that could harm the relationship.
